  • Publication number: 20110227688
    Abstract: There is provided a planar transformer having improved performance through a reduction in heat generation by removing part of a conductor from a substrate. The planar transformer includes a core part having a pair of cores being electromagnetically coupled to each other; a substrate part having at least one substrate disposed between the pair of cores; a pattern part formed on the at least one substrate and including a conductor having an adjustable width; and an opening part including a non-conductor allowing for variations in the width of the conductor of the pattern part.

  • Patent number: 6712488
    Abstract: An electrodeless lighting apparatus using microwave comprises: a waveguide for transmitting microwave generated in a magnetron; a mesh screen coupled to an outlet portion of the waveguide for blocking a leakage of the microwave and passing light; a bulb located in the mesh screen for emitting light by generating plasma by the microwave; and a globe installed on outer area of the mesh screen so that the light generated in the bulb can be radiated to omnidirection, that is, the globe is installed around the bulb instead of a reflector and a light guide which are used in the conventional art, and thereby, a structure of the lighting apparatus can be made simply and an omnidirectional lighting can be performed.

  • Patent number: 6225828
    Abstract: Disclosed is a decoder capable of saving power consumption. The decoder according to the present invention is capable of reducing power consumption without a chip area increase which is caused by the modification of an inverter. The decoder in a semiconductor device comprising NAND gates receiving addresses, BiCMOS inverters for inverting outputs from the NAND gates, a clock generator for providing a clock signal for the NAND gates, to control outputs from the BiCMOS inverters in response to the clock signal. Particularly, the decoder according to the present invention reduces power consumption in a stand-by state.
